Analysis

In 2024, insurance and financial services in Madagascar stood at 1.4%.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 26.8% on the previous year and up 197.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, insurance and financial services in Madagascar peaked at 5.0% in 1977 and was at its lowest, 0.2%, in 2008.

That places Madagascar 188th out of 197 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Insurance and financial services cover various types of insurance provided to nonresidents by resident insurance enterprises and vice versa, and financial intermediary and auxiliary services (except those of insurance enterprises and pension funds) exchanged between residents and nonresidents. This indicator is expressed as a percentage of service imports which are services provided by non-residents to residents.
